6.12.2 ETHERNET
The Network Interface Board (NIB) is
a standard IEEE 802.3u type that
implements 10/100 Mbps auto
negotiation. System initialization sets
the network for 10 Mbps/100 Mbps.
The Ethernet interface unit has two
LEDs–orange [A] and green [B].
These LEDs indicate the status of
the Ethernet interface unit. The table
lists the indications of these LEDs.
LED Function Status
On: 100 Mbps mode
Orange [A] Indicates the operation mode
Off: 10 Mbps mode
On: Link Safe
Green [B] Indicates the link status
Off: Link Fail
